At what distance is the first image from the first lens? Answer in units of m. What is the magnification of the first image? At what distance is the second image from the second lens? Answer in units of m. What is the magnification of the final image, when compared to the initial object?

Solution

1/p + 1/q = 1/f

f1 = 5.9 m, f2 = -2.4 m, p1 = 10 m, l = 9.46 m

1/q1 = 1/5.9 - 1/10

q1 = 14.39 m

-------------------------------------------------------

m1 = -q1/p1 = -14.39 / 10

m1 = -1.439

-------------------------------------------------------

p2 = l - q1 = 9.46 - 14.39 = -4.93 m

1/q2 = 1/-2.4 - 1/-4.93

q2 = -4.68 m

--------------------------------------------------

m2 = -q2 / p2 = 4.68 / -4.93

= -0.949

mfinal = m1 * m2 = 1.36
